Vasalli and Vasallo are almost unique, could be due to alterations of the surname Vaselli, which is typical of the area that includes Tuscany, the Pesarese, Umbria and Lazio central North, Vasello, almost unique too, it would appear Campano, should Derive from the Latin name Vasellus (a betacistic alteration of the name Basilus) of which we have an example in Bellum contra Mitridatem: ".. Vasellus aeque unus de percussoribus Cesaris servorum suorum Manu Necatus est. Fugatus Antonius Amissoque Exercitu in Hispanias confugit ad lepidum, here Cesaris magister equitum Fuerat et tum magnas militum copys habebat. A Quo Antonius susceptus EST
